Industry Trends Shaping Cosmetic Packaging

The cosmetics industry is undergoing a transformation as sustainability becomes a top priority for brands and consumers alike. Several trends are influencing packaging decisions, and ASME is at the forefront of these developments:

  • Minimalist Packaging: Consumers are gravitating towards minimalist designs that use fewer materials and emphasize functionality over excess. ASME has developed lightweight packaging solutions that reduce material usage without compromising on quality.
  • Refillable Packaging: Refillable cosmetic containers are gaining popularity as a sustainable alternative to single-use packaging. ASME offers innovative refillable options that allow consumers to reuse containers, reducing waste.
  • Smart Packaging: The integration of technology into packaging, such as QR codes and NFC tags, enables brands to communicate their sustainability efforts directly to consumers. ASME has pioneered smart packaging solutions that enhance consumer engagement while supporting ESG goals.

Regulatory Landscape and Its Impact on Packaging

Governments and regulatory bodies worldwide are introducing stringent guidelines to promote sustainable packaging. From bans on single-use plastics to mandatory recycling targets, these regulations are shaping the future of cosmetic packaging. ASME stays ahead of these changes by proactively adapting its products to comply with emerging standards.

For example, the European Union’s Packaging and Packaging Waste Directive has set ambitious recycling targets for member states. ASME has aligned its operations with these requirements, ensuring that its packaging solutions meet the highest environmental standards.
